Good To Know
- A 4-hour guided hike on the Vatnajokull Glacier, the largest ice cap in Europe, offering breathtaking views of the Fjallsarlon Glacier Lagoon.
- Exploration of icy terrains, crevasses, and the dynamic glacial environment, led by certified guides with a 5-star rating.
- Immersive small-group experience (max 10 participants) focused on understanding glacier formation, dynamics, and environmental significance.
- Essential equipment like crampons, helmets, and harnesses provided, with transfers to the trailhead included.
- Suitable for fit participants; children under 14 and those with mobility issues excluded due to the demanding nature of the hike.

Participant Requirements
Not all adventurers are welcomed on this Arctic glacier hike. This icy trek requires a certain level of agility and fitness. Children under 14 and those with mobility issues won’t be able to safely navigate the crevasses and uneven terrain.
Participants should come prepared with appropriate gear – sturdy hiking boots, waterproof outerwear, hat, gloves, and a small backpack. While rental gear is available, bringing your own tried-and-true equipment is recommended.

Environmental Significance
Beneath the glistening ice flows, glaciers play a crucial role in the delicate balance of the Arctic environment. As massive reservoirs of freshwater, they regulate global sea levels and influence ocean currents, affecting weather patterns worldwide.
The retreat of these mighty ice sheets also reveals a sobering truth – the profound impact of climate change on fragile ecosystems. Witnessing the thundering calving of glacier walls firsthand underscores the urgency to protect these natural wonders.
